Cheer Gear Clothing Market Set to Expand as Customization and Youth Sports Gain Momentum

The global cheer gear clothing industry is gaining momentum as participation in cheerleading, youth sports, fitness activities, and performance-oriented apparel continues to expand. Changing fashion preferences are also encouraging consumers to seek athletic clothing that combines functionality, comfort, personalization, and style. At the same time, digital retail and social media are giving brands new opportunities to reach athletes, teams, schools, and cheer communities.

According to WiseGuyReports, the Cheer Gear Clothing Market was valued at USD 3.64 billion in 2024 and is expected to increase from USD 3.84 billion in 2025 to USD 6.5 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 5.4% during the forecast period. Rising cheerleading participation, demand for customized apparel, youth sports engagement, fabric innovation, and expanding online retail channels are among the factors shaping the industry’s outlook.

Performance Fabrics Transform Cheer Apparel

Fabric technology is playing an increasingly important role in product development. Cheerleaders require apparel that can support flexibility, movement, comfort, and performance during demanding routines.

Moisture-wicking materials are gaining attention because they can help manage perspiration during training and performances. Stretchable fabrics can provide greater freedom of movement, while lightweight materials can improve comfort during extended use.

Smart textile technology represents another potential area of development. Advanced fabrics capable of integrating performance-related features could eventually create additional differentiation for specialized athletic apparel.

These developments are encouraging manufacturers to combine fashion-oriented designs with increasingly sophisticated performance characteristics.

Cheerleading Uniforms Remain a Core Product Category

The industry is segmented into cheerleading uniforms, practice wear, cheer shoes, and accessories. Cheerleading uniforms represent a particularly important category because they are central to team identity and competitive performances.

Practice wear provides another significant opportunity as athletes require dedicated clothing for training sessions. The emphasis is increasingly shifting toward apparel that combines flexibility, durability, comfort, and contemporary styling.

Specialized cheer shoes also remain important because footwear needs to support movement and performance. Accessories provide additional opportunities for personalization and team branding.

This broad product ecosystem enables companies to serve athletes across multiple stages of their cheerleading experience.

Supply Chain and Cost Management Remain Important

Despite favorable opportunities, manufacturers must manage challenges involving raw material costs, production efficiency, inventory, seasonal demand, and changing consumer preferences.

Apparel companies also need to balance customization with manufacturing efficiency. Highly personalized products can create additional production complexity, particularly when orders involve different sizes, designs, materials, and delivery requirements.

Efficient digital ordering systems, demand forecasting, flexible manufacturing, and reliable supplier relationships can help companies address these challenges.
